Why Free-to-Play Players Struggle in Throne and Liberty(250+ hours)
After completing daily co-op dungeons in just 30 minutes, I feel that no other event offers worthwhile rewards. Even after the reward update patch, it’s still not enough. I've attended nearly all the world boss events, but I’ve only received a purple item once. The Sauroma night event is dominated by whale zerg players, making it nearly impossible to farm any chests there. At some point, you hit a wall, and it feels like you need to invest at least $100 just to meet the bar for a good build.

Some players have gotten lucky, earning good gear and selling it for a significant amount of lucent, but it's as rare as winning the lottery. Every PvP event is controlled by one large guild, leaving no content for smaller guilds. I check the player count every day, and it’s easy to see why people are leaving. Pay-to-win players progress rapidly, while free-to-play players struggle to catch up, unable to grind due to restrictions.

For free-to-play players, Throne and Liberty becomes boring over time because the game doesn’t reward them in any meaningful way. The imbalance between pay-to-win and free-to-play players makes progression frustrating, limiting the overall enjoyment and engagement for non-paying players.
